My waitlist number is 608 in first merit list for SLS Hyderabad, is there any chances for admission?

Symbiosis Law School (SLS), Hyderabad, is a private institute affiliated with Symbiosis International, deemed to be a university (SIU). At the undergraduate level, the institute offers two five-year integrated programs, B.A. LL.B. And BBA LL.B. Every year, SLS Hyderabad admissions are conducted for these courses on the basis of a cut-off declared by SLS Hyderabad, and the institute admits more than 100 students in all these programs. With waiting list item 608, there is a 10-15% Probability of making the cut. Recently, it announced a third merit list, which is available to check on their website.

Dear aspirant, Glad to meet you. Eligibility to become Teacher:
To become a teacher in India, it is very important for candidates to have a Bachelors degree in education (B.Ed). One can also pursue a Masters degree in the same (M. Ed) to add to their qualification and to increase ones employability. Ed. Diploma in Education (D. Ed. ) is a 2 year certified teacher training course after 12th that will equip you with the knowledge required to teach at elementary schools (as nursery school teachers). The minimum eligibility is 50% marks in class 12th from a recognised board/school. For more information please visit this link

As per mou (ministry of defence clause) no. 13 sub clause (d).
1) 80% (General/Open) seats are for dependents of defence personnel. And as per merit there selection will be done.
2) 10% (Defence special category) seats are for dependents of defence personnel. This special category are for those who lost there life in war or war like operations while serving for the military or suffer 50% disability. As per merit there selection will be done.
3) 10% (open category) seats are for civilian candidate.

Is Symbiosis Law, Noida good?

SLS, Noida is near to the National Capital which is the home of the Supreme Court. This enables more opportunities for practical learning and Delhi is also good for law firms other areas of law. The Noida campus even has better faculty than SLS, Pune and has established its name as one of the good college in the law field. The campus is also newly build recently and the new building is very modern and technically sufficient. Placements are fine. Not everyone gets a placement but those who get are provided good jobs. Most of the people choose to go for PG after this course. From 7th-8th Semester students become eligible for placements. 30% students get placements. All the faculty is well-qualified in their fields and the teaching method is also pretty good as they provide enough materials and library is big and the teachers are always available for answering any queries. The whole school is very punctual of classes, exams, teachers too and the rules are strict for attendance.

SCMC Pune course fee is INR 9.20 Lacs. The eligibility criteria for B.A. Mass Communication offered by Symbiosis Centre for Media and Communication is that students must have completed 10+2 or 10+3 with a minimum of 50% (45% in case of SC/ST) marks from a recognised board.
